Fly responses to food colour, orientation and toxic bait composition in Drosophila suzukii

Rodrigo Lasa,
Saide Aguas‐Lanzagorta,
Trevor Williams

Abstract: Toxic baits comprising a combination of food attractants and a toxicant could contribute to the control of the spotted wing drosophila, Drosophila suzukii (Diptera: Drosophilidae), a major invasive pest of soft fruit and berries. Laboratory cage experiments revealed that flies of both sexes were significantly more attracted to dried red droplets of 0.3% sucrose solution and were more likely to consume red‐coloured droplets compared to blue, green or colourless droplets.
